5 Attlee Avenue is a semi-detached house in Culcheth, Warrington, Warrington (WA3 5JA). It has a recorded floor area of 104 m² (around 1123 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(April 2011) shows an E (score 53),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 66). The latest certificate is from April 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 104 m² the property is well over the postcode median (68 m² across 17 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ement.
